Just wanted members to know about a company that really takes care of its customers. I have a 10 month old Grado RA1 amp and a wire broke on 9 volt battery connectors, bottom plate cannot be remove now because of unique fastners, so home fix not possible.

Sent e-mail to Grado, they said send it in for repair. Amp was repaired in two days and shipped back to me, no charge for repairs or return shipping!

How many companies do you know that will match that service?
